Emanuel Berg <moasen@zoho.com> writes:
> Narendra Joshi <narendraj9@gmail.com> writes:
>
>> I use elfeed and Gnus. I would like to be able to
>> read articles in Emacs. Most of the articles spread
>> across the width of Emacs windows. I would like to
>> limit the column upto which text is shown to say 80.
>> That would make reading easier for me. I don't like
>> having a huge number of words in a single line of
>> the buffer. How can I achieve this?
>
> Try this:
>
> (setq message-fill-column 54)
That would affect message composition buffers, right? I understood the
OP to be asking about reading articles, in which case "W Q" might be
what the doctor ordered.
